NEW APIs [Hillary Clinton Email Archive API] The [Hillary Clinton Email Archive API]contains the 30,322 emails and email attachments sent to and from Hillary Clinton's private email server while she was Secretary of State. [Block Explorer REST API] The [Block Explorer REST API]offers Bitcoin blockchain information. This allows developers to view real-time information about blocks, addresses, and transactions. [Block Explorer Web Socket API] The [Block Explorer Web Socket API]offers real-time Bitcoin transactions, status and block information. [datasnap.io Event API] The [datasnap.io Event API]allows developers to send all of the events they want to analyze to the datasnap.io system from their apps. [datasnap.io Entity API] The [datasnap.io Entity API] allows developers to populate all major entities that they use in their reporting and analytics. [The Nutritionix Track API] The [The Nutritionix Track API] powers the Nutritionix Track mobile app. It can be combined with the v1.1 Nutritionix Branded Foods API to create a nutrition logging experience for your health and fitness apps. Flesch reading score

Flesch reading score measures how complex a text is. The lower the score, the more difficult the text is to read. The Flesch readability score uses the average length of your sentences (measured by the number of words) and the average number of syllables per word in an equation to calculate the reading ease. Text with a very high Flesch reading ease score (about 100) is straightforward and easy to read, with short sentences and no words of more than two syllables. Usually, a reading ease score of 60-70 is considered acceptable/normal for web copy.
